Lately I've experienced some problems with AVG Free Antivirus(latest
version 7.5xxx).
First about a week ago each automatic daily dat update required a reboot
( I've since figured that one out two seting had been changed, this
change wasn't done by my had I know),
Second problem was a number of old files started to get labled as virus,
trojan and what have you, These files were various programs that had
resided in a folder that had been scanned numerous times before with no
problems ...some files were two to three years old.
Most were deleted or sent to the vault by AVG.
I have suspected that AVG was giving false positives but wasn't sure.
Today during the scan AdbeRdr70_DLM_enu_full.exe gave a warning it
contained Trojon horse SHEUR CKV.
This was a direct download from Adobe so I don't think it is a problem.

Does the free version not allow you to alter the test settings?,not to
"automatically heal"?and allow you a choice of what to do with the
suspect file?.Any av that automatically heals/deletes a file may cause
problems and that setting should be avoided.A deleted file can usually be
restored from the vault.
